Patch Picks: Local Boutiques

Our weekly guide of things to do and places to go in Commack. This week, we highlight some boutique stores in the area.

Big chain department stores may be convenient, but they often can't match the selection and experience of speciality boutique stores. Here's some local shops to stop by this weekend:

: Whether you're learning how to two-step, practicing your waltz or in the market for new ballet shoes, Dancer's Closet has all you need to hit the dancer floor looking your best.

: Lady Gaga's incredible costumes and outfits don't come from any department store or retailer--they get made with her own two hands and a huge assortment of materials. If creating your own get-up strikes your fancy, Fabrics $1 to $3 has everything you'll need, and free demonstrations on how to use anything you buy.

: Don't be fooled by the name--Mr. Cheapo does have tons of CDs, but he also sells every other circular media format known to man, like DVDs, laser discs and Blu-ray, as well as cassettes and audio books.

: If nothing lights your fire like a quality cigar, J & R's has you covered, also stocking lighters, trimmers and all the necessary smoking accoutrements.

: If it's a Jewish gift you're after, Chai & Mazel has plenty to choose from, including cookbooks, kipas, Mezuzahs and more.
